#2: Black and White Money Piece

The black-and-white money piece is a bold and trendy choice for those who love to make a statement. This style features bright blonde sections framing the face, creating a striking contrast against a dark base for a look that’s both edgy and sophisticated.

Achieving this effect involves the color-blocking technique, where select strands are lightened to a platinum blonde level and finished with an icy gloss. This process enhances the vibrancy and shine of the lighter sections, ensuring they stand out beautifully against the darker backdrop.

Before committing to this dramatic transformation, it’s crucial to assess your hair’s health. Bleaching to platinum can be intense, so ensuring your strands can withstand the process without breaking is essential. A consultation with a professional stylist is highly recommended—they can evaluate your hair’s condition, suggest the safest approach, and guide you through achieving this look with minimal damage.

The black-and-white money piece is more than a trend; it’s a sophisticated way to express individuality. While it’s a daring style, it exudes elegance and transforms your hair into a true work of art.

#11: Short Icy Platinum Blonde Hair

The short icy platinum blonde look is the perfect choice for anyone looking to embody winter elegance with a touch of boldness. This striking, queen-of-ice style is all about achieving a luminous, frosty shade that demands attention.

To create this look, start by applying bleach globally, targeting pale yellow or lighter tones as the base. This initial lightening process sets the stage for the next step. Once the desired lightness is achieved, follow up with a glaze or toner in shades of violet, pearl, or silver. These cool tones neutralize any remaining yellow hues, enhancing the icy platinum effect and adding a shimmering, dimensional quality to your hair.

For the best results, make sure to fully dry your hair before applying toner. This ensures that you can accurately assess the changes in color and make any necessary adjustments to the toning formula.

By following these steps, you can embrace the captivating allure of icy platinum blonde and make a bold, glamorous statement this winter.

#12: Toasty Pink with Dark Roots

The trendy combination of dark roots blending into mauve pink balayage has become a winter favorite, known for its versatility and flattering nature on various skin tones. This unique hue offers a perfect balance of cool and warm tones, creating a soft, radiant glow on both light and dark complexions, making it universally appealing.

For medium-length hair, this color scheme enhances the illusion of longer, updated tresses, making it a great choice for those looking to refresh their look.

To maintain the vibrancy and health of your mauve pink balayage, it’s essential to use gentle, color-safe hair care products. Opting for sulfate-free and paraben-free products, like Olaplex No. 4 Bond Maintenance Shampoo and Olaplex No. 5 Bond Maintenance Conditioner, will help preserve the color’s intensity, protect it from fading, and enhance its shine.

Additionally, washing your hair with cold water can prevent premature fading, ensuring your mauve pink balayage stays fresh and radiant throughout the winter season.
